ANIMAL CHARM: GOLDEN DIGEST (1996) 86'
Description
Animal Charm makes videos from other people's videos. By recomposing television excerpts to the point of reducing them to a kind of visual and sonic stutter, they force television to lose its meaning. While this disruption remains playful, it also reveals an 'essence' of mass culture that could not otherwise be discerned. Pieces like Stuffing, Ashley or Lightfoot Fever disrupt the hypnotism of television spectacle, revealing how advertising generates anxiety, how culture constructs "nature," and how conventional morality is dictated through seemingly neutral images.
By pushing television to convulse, perhaps we can finally hear what it's really saying.
"Animal Charm uses image and sound to provoke a particular kind of laughter: the unsettling kind that seizes you like a seizure."
— Johnny Ray Huston, San Francisco Bay Guardian
